The Health and Safety (First Aid) Regulations 1981 apply to workplaces in the UK, including those with less than five employees, and to the self-employed. This Approved Code of Practice (ACOP) and guidance is aimed at all industries, although guidance on first aid in mines, offshore and diving is covered in separate publications. It sets out the aspects of first aid that employers need to address, offering practical advice on what they need to do, and aims to help employers understand and comply with the Regulations. This second edition provides details of a new training regime for first-aiders in the workplace. It has been revised to give employers greater flexibility in determining their first-aid provision and to recommend annual refresher training for first-aiders to help maintain their skills.
